Bournemouth, Swansea and Luton Town keen on Cameron Carter-Vickers

According to the Daily Mail, forgotten Tottenham Hotspur defender Cameron Carter-Vickers is a man in demand in the EFL Championship with three clubs vying for his signature.

Carter-Vickers is a product of the Tottenham youth academy. He made his first-team debut back in 2016 but has featured just four times for the senior team so far. The 22-year-old has had loan spells at Swansea City, Ipswich Town and Sheffield United in the past.

The USMNT defender spent the first half of the 2019/20 campaign on loan at Stoke City. He then joined Luton Town for the second half of the term. Carter-Vickers played an integral role as they managed to stave off the threat of relegation and retain their Championship status for another season.

Carter-Vickers is in the final year of his contract with Tottenham

He ended the last season with a total 31 appearances across all competitions – 15 for Stoke City and 16 for Luton Town, for whom he also grabbed an assist.

While he impressed with the Championship side, the youngster is not part of the plans at Tottenham under Jose Mourinho. He had already been informed to find a new club by the North London outfit. (h/t Herts Live)

And, as per the report from Daily Mail, three clubs from the Championship – Bournemouth, Swansea City and Luton Town are all keen on bringing him in this summer.

Given that the defender isn’t in Mourinho’s plans and in the final year of his contract as well, a permanent transfer makes sense for both the player and the club.
